Can the U.S. men’s track team win gold in Paris?

1 min read

At the last Summer Olympics, not a single American man won gold in track. This year, track superstars, including Noah Lyles, are trying to set the record straight on Paris’s purple track. The Washington Post’s Ava Wallace speaks with reporter Adam Kilgore about the start of track and field and which men and women to watch.
